Catwalk Worldwide Pvt. Ltd. recently launched its new stores in G7 Mall at Andheri, Mumbai and in Nagpur at Empress Mall. Spread over 5000sq.ft at Andheri and 885sq.ft at Nagpur, the new Catwalk stores are more spacious and offer a unique customer shopping experience.

Taking the ladies footwear category in general, the business is primarily unorganized in nature thereby presenting a lot of potential for a shoe giant like 'Catwalk'.
Catwalk Worldwide aims to achieve Rs. 5bn turnover by financial year 2014-15 i.e. Catwalk anticipates its revenue to grow at a CAGR of approximately 88%. With a well equipped Business Development team in place and a well chalked out strategy - Catwalk's plans include setting up additional 190 standalone stores (total stores 220) including franchisees covering an area of approximately 114,000 sq ft by the end of financial year 2014-15 taking the total area to over 125,000 sq. ft. with an estimated investment of approximately Rs 550 mn. Catwalk is looking at metros, satellite cities, tier I and Tier II towns as well as international destinations for its expansion plans.
